What is the technology provider for Web Protection?
Our web protection is powered by DNS Filter. DNS filtering is a defense tool that prevents cybersecurity threats by following simple logic: if a website has something potentially dangerous within it, DNS filtering blocks a user from visiting it in the first place. It’s a zero-trust solution that leaves nothing to chance.
What's covered in Web Protection powered by DNSFilter?
Content Filtering
Select from a wide variety of Filtering Categories to block or allow at your discretion.
Unlimited Block/Allow List
DNSFilter allows an unlimited number of domains to be added to the policy Allow list/Block list, allowing you to have complete customization over which domains and subdomains you want users to access. CSV import of domain lists is supported.
Realtime Categorization
Newly seen domains are categorized in real-time by our Artificial Intelligence scanning engine. The average domain is categorized in 5-15 seconds.
Threat Protection
Threat Categories
DNSFilter uses a multi-pronged approach toward security, which results in robust threat intelligence. Users can block sources of Malware and Phishing, as well as next-gen threats such as Botnets and Cryptomining. DNSFilter utilizes threat feeds maintained by the global security community and reported by humans resulting in highly reliable data.
